Multichannel R-matrix analysis of elastic and inelastic resonances in the Na21+ p compound system

Abstract

A multichannel R-matrix formalism was used to fit Na21+ p resonant elastic and inelastic scattering data taken at the TRIUMF UK detector array facility at TRIUMF-ISAC. Five resonances were observed corresponding to states in Mg22 above the proton threshold. Four of these corresponded to states seen in previous transfer reaction studies where firm spin-parity assignments could not be made. One new resonance, previously unobserved in any reaction, was also seen. Where possible, resonance energies, partial widths, and spin-parity values of these resonances were extracted. The correspondence between these states and possible analogs in the mirror nucleus Ne22 is discussed, as well as the relation to T=1 states in the nucleus Na22.
